7 Industries That Let You Be Your Own Boss

If you?re looking for better ways to take control of your finances and expand your wealth, being your own boss can put you in the driver?s seat. There are certain industries that offer you the opportunity to work for yourself and set your own rules. Some of these fields require a certain level of education and training to get started, but you?ll likely reap the rewards if you?re willing to put in the extra time and effort. You can find potentially lucrative self-employment opportunities in any of these industries.

Financial Planning

Many people need assistance with managing their finances, and you can help by offering your services as a financial planner. To get started in this industry, you?ll need to complete the necessary training to earn your certification. You can find programs at local universities that will prepare you to enter this field. You?ll then have the opportunity to start your own business and assist people with everything from retirement planning to setting up trust funds to pay for college and other important expenses.

Bookkeeping

If you are good with numbers and have excellent organizational skills, this industry may offer you the perfect way to make your self-employment dreams come true. You?ll generally need some type of accounting degree and the proper certification to get started in this industry. Businesses and individuals will hire you to balance their books and help manage their spending. It?s best to learn about the latest accounting software programs that will enable you to perform your work more efficiently.

Real Estate

After going through the necessary schooling and training to obtain your Realtor license, you can start working as a real estate agent. In the beginning stages, you may choose to work for an established agency that lets you set your own work schedule and earn commissions on each sale you close. Once you have enough experience, you can then start your own real estate firm and hire other agents to manage the bulk of your clients. Writing

Writers are always in demand, and it?s often quite easy to find freelance work if you have the right skills and connections. Proficiency in proper grammar and spelling is essential if you expect to have longevity in this industry. Many large companies and small businesses are willing to pay good money to people who know how to write effective website copy, blogs and other posts that can draw the right kind of attention from potential new clients. You may even be asked to write full-length books or undertake other larger projects.

Business Consulting

As a business consultant, you?ll be able to establish your own service-based business and help other companies improve upon their operations. If you have an MBA from an accredited business school and possess enough experience performing certain duties required in this field, you can earn a lucrative income while being your own boss. Clients will hire you to find solutions to certain problems that may be hindering their business development. You?ll need to carefully analyze how a particular company functions so that you can address all the issues that need attention. You may also be asked to help with financial planning and making other important company decisions.

Online Coaching

The Internet has provided numerous self-employment opportunities, and online coaching has proven to be one of the most lucrative. In addition, this industry gives you the freedom to work directly from your home or any other facility that?s ideal for you. Whether you want to be a life coach or fitness trainer, you can connect online with clients who are willing to pay for your services. You can stay in contact with your clients through video chats and emails. You?ll be responsible for tracking each client?s progress and offering guidance along the way.

Genealogy

This industry is often overlooked when it comes to self-employment opportunities, but you could potentially make an excellent living for yourself by working as a genealogist. You?ll help people research their family history and discover their true heritage. Enough information will need to be gathered about distant relatives in order to create accurate family trees. You can choose to offer your services online or set up an office to meet with your clients. Although there are no specific education requirements, it would be advantageous for you to have a college degree and become a member of a genealogical organization. Excellent research skills are also a must.

Any of these industries may allow you to become your own boss and gain a greater sense of financial freedom. In addition to helping yourself, the services you provide can be highly beneficial for clients who will rely on your expertise to solve their problems.
